FOUNDATION and ANCHORING REQUIREMENTS

1.

Concrete shall have compression strength of at least 3,000 PSI and a minimum thickness
of 4” in order to achieve a minimum anchor embedment of 3 1/4”. NOTE: When using the
standard supplied 3/4” x 5 1/2 long anchors; if the top of the anchor exceeds 2 1/4” above
the floor grade, you DO NOT have enough embedment.


2.

Maintain a 6” minimum distance from any slab edge or seam. Hole to hole spacing
should be a minimum 61/2” in any direction. Hole depth should be a minimum of 4”.


CAUTION!!

3.

DO NOT install on asphalt or other similar unstable surface. Columns are supported only
by anchoring to floor.

4.

Using the horseshoe shims provided, shim each column base as required until each
column is plumb. If one column has to be elevated to match the plane of the other column,
full size base shim plates should be used. Torque anchors to 85 ft-lbs. Shim thickness
MUST NOT exceed ½” when using the 5 1/2” long anchors provided with the lift. Adjust
the column extensions plumb.

5.

If anchors do not tighten to 85 ft-lbs. installation torque, replace the concrete under each
column base with a 4’ x 4’ x 6” thick 3,000 PSI minimum concrete pad keyed under and
flush with the top of existing floor. Allow concrete to cure before installing lifts and
anchors (typically 2 to 3 weeks).
